The History of Air Jordan 1

Air Jordan 1 was first released in 1985 and was designed by Peter Moore. The shoe was initially banned by the NBA because it did not meet the league’s uniform standards. However, Michael Jordan continued to wear the shoe and Nike paid the fines for him. The shoe’s popularity skyrocketed and it became one of the most sought-after shoes in the world.
